Exped - Gemini II - 2-person tent
At a glance
Material information & features
- Recommended use:
- trekking
- Collection:
- previous model
- Fly:
- 100% polyamide
- Body:
- 100% polyamide
- Floor:
- 100% polyamide
- Fabric treatment:
- taped seams, PU coated, silicone-coated
- Hydrostatic head main material:
- 1,500 mm
- Hydrostatic head floor:
- 5,000 mm
- Number of people:
- 2
- Pole system:
- TRX Airlite 9.1 mm; Aluminium: 7001-T6"
- Freestanding:
- yes
- Number of entrances:
- 2
- Number of vestibules:
- 2
- Dimensions (outer):
- L: 230 cm; Width: 305 cm, Total height: 118 cm;
- Dimensions (interior):
- L: 220 cm; Width: 125 cm; Interior height: 110 cm; Sleeping area: 275 cm²
- Packed dimensions:
- 45 x 17 cm
- Weight:
- 2,400 g
- Extras:
- free-standing; steep tent walls and spacious; sitting height for 2 people; Guy lines attach directly to the pole structure;
- Item No.:
- 520-0492
Product description
Steep tent walls, sitting height in the centre with room enough for 2 people, 2 large tent entrances and 2 large vestibules with 2 m² each. They're perfect for cooking, storage, taking off your dirty boots or for packing without bothering your travel buddy. The Exped Gemini II boasts all the features a trekking fan could ever dream of: For one, it boasts a free-standing construction, which is perfect for warm summer nights, as it will allow you to pitch just the inner tent. It's quick and easy! You'll love the relatively low weight and extremely small pack size of this tent as well. Plus, you can divide up the poles, pegs, footprint (if you have one) among you and your travel buddy to makes things even lighter! Another great thing about this tent is the extremely lightweight, but robust materials used for the inner tent and fly as well as the seam-sealed floor. The Gemini II also comes complete with a No-See-Um mosquito net to shield you from those pesky creatures as well as steep tent walls for plenty of storage. Of course, there are mesh pockets and loops in the inner tent you can use to store or hang up your head torch, sunglasses and other small items. In sum: If you love travelling in a group of two and want a spacious tent with excellent features, the Gemini II is an excellent choice!
